Heavy Metal Contamination in Broths

How Contamination Occurs

Lead enters powdered broth products through several pathways that most consumers never see. The main culprit? The manufacturing process itself.

Raw materials used in powdered broths may come from plants grown in contaminated soil. Crops absorb metals from the ground, bringing them into the food chain. This problem gets worse near industrial areas or in countries with less strict farming regulations.

Processing equipment can also introduce metals. Old machinery, metal grinding processes, and even the water used during manufacturing might contain trace amounts of lead. When companies dry broths into powder form, these contaminants become concentrated.

Packaging materials present another risk factor. Some ink dyes and plastic compounds contain heavy metals that can leach into food products over time. The longer a powdered broth sits on the shelf, the greater this risk becomes.

Health Risks of Lead

Lead exposure through food creates serious health concerns that build up slowly but can last a lifetime. Even small amounts matter more than you might think.

Your brain faces the biggest threat from lead exposure. Children show reduced IQ scores, learning disabilities, and behavior problems with even low-level exposure. Adults aren't immune either – lead contributes to memory issues and mood changes over time.

Your blood pressure might climb due to regular lead consumption. Studies link lead exposure to high blood pressure and increased risk of heart disease. This happens because lead damages blood vessels and disrupts your kidney function.

Pregnant women face special risks since lead crosses the placenta. This means your developing baby receives these toxins directly, potentially causing growth problems and developmental delays before birth.

The worst part? Your body stores lead in your bones for decades. This creates a long-term internal source of exposure as your bones naturally release stored lead into your bloodstream throughout your life.

Why Do Powdered Broths Contain Lead?

Powdered broths pick up lead through multiple steps in their production journey. The path from farm to package creates several exposure points.

The concentration process itself increases lead levels. When manufacturers reduce liquid broth to powder form, they concentrate everything, including any contaminants present in the original liquid. This means even low levels in the starting material can become problematic.

Raw ingredients often bring lead with them. Commercial operations may use bones from animals raised in areas with contaminated soil or water. Plants grown for flavoring ingredients might absorb metals from agricultural soils treated with phosphate fertilizers, which frequently contain lead as a contaminant.

Processing equipment contributes additional exposure. Metal grinding surfaces, old pipes, and industrial machinery can all introduce small amounts of lead during manufacturing. These traces add up in the final product.

Cost-cutting measures sometimes lead companies to source ingredients from regions with fewer environmental regulations. This creates a higher risk of contamination from industrial pollution or unsafe farming practices that wouldn't be permitted in countries with stricter standards.
